Scorcher is an unstable/delusional Infernian extremist who tried to assassinate president Olivia Marsdin, due to the alien amnesty act.

Powers and abilities

Powers

  • Infernian physiology: Like every infernian, scorcher has special abilities
    • Pyrogenesis: Scorcher is able to generate fire from her body, which she can form into fireballs. She can also produce enough heat to cause solar-powered kryptonians mild pain.
      • Heat vision: Scorcher is able to shoot concentrated fiery beams out of her eyes, which could be strong enough to physically repel a Kryptonian.
    • Pyrokinesis: Scorcher is able to manipulate fire.
    • Super strength: Scorcher possesses sufficient strength to put up a fight against solar-powered kryptonians, however is not quite as strong as them.
    • Super durability: Scorcher is more durable than humans, able to withstand repetitive hits from several sources. however, she is not bulletproof (she repetitively avoided being shot) and can be knocked down even by humans, if those activate enough force (Maggie Sawyer knocked her down by hitting her over the head with a pipe). She is also heat-proof and fire-proof.

Behind the scenes

  • There are several characters, mostly super-villains, with the name Scorcher in the DC comics, though only three are female and are related to the element of fire:
    • Cynthia Brand debuted in Scare Tactics #3 (February, 1997) and was created by Len Kaminski and Anthony Williams.
    • An unnamed woman, who was a member of the super-villain team known as Dark Nemesis, debuted in Teen Titans vol. 2, #7 (April, 1997). The character was created by Dan Jurgens and George Pérez.
    • Aubrey Sparks (also known as Scorch) debuted in Superman vol. 2 #160 (September, 2000) and was created by John DeMatteis and Mike Miller.
  • Scorcher resembles in appearance another super-villain and enemy of Superman from the DC universe, Claire Selton a.k.a. Volcana. The character first appeared in Superman: The Animated Series, in the episode "Where There's Smoke", voiced by Peri Gilpin. Besides from the similar skillset, both characters have red hair and wear clothes with colour themes of different variations of red.
